SGG PREPARES MULTI-NATION CARD ON JULY 7 BEFORE JETTING OFF FOR HOPKINS-WRIGHT SUPERBOUT!

By Salven L. Lagumbay
PhilBoxing.com
Sat, 16 Jun 2007


Sammy Gello-ani (R) and Sampson Lewkowicz.
The country's top boxing promoter, Sammy Gello-ani, has informed today that his July 7 card at the posh Waterfront Cebu City Hotel will be a multi-nation event.

Gello-ani is busy preparing the show, and it will be the biggest card he will do before he flies to Las Vegas to be at ringside for the Bernard Hopkins-Winky Wright superbout where ALA boy Czar Amonsot is seeing action on the undercard.

"There will be six Koreans, two Indonesians, and two Thais seeing action on the card on July 7," informed Gello-ani, while confirming that WBO Asia Pacific interim bantamweight champion Robert Allanic is not seeing action.

"This is going to be a memorable card, which will be beamed live back in Korea, and will be aired also in the Philippines. This is in partnership with Boxing Plaza Entertainment and Mr. Lee," added the multi-titled boxing promoter and manager.
